PVE虚拟机网络管理实战指南
pve虚拟机网络管理

首页 2025-02-07 06:01:52



PVE虚拟机网络管理:高效、灵活与安全的基石 在当今数字化时代,虚拟化技术已成为数据中心运营不可或缺的一部分

    Proxmox Virtual Environment(简称PVE)作为开源虚拟化解决方案的佼佼者,凭借其强大的功能集、高度的可扩展性和对多种虚拟化技术的支持,赢得了广泛的认可

    其中,PVE虚拟机网络管理是其核心功能之一,直接关系到虚拟环境的性能、灵活性和安全性

    本文将深入探讨PVE虚拟机网络管理的关键要素、实施策略及其带来的显著优势,旨在帮助IT管理员和系统架构师更好地理解并优化其虚拟网络架构

     一、PVE虚拟机网络管理的重要性 虚拟机网络管理是虚拟化环境中的一项基础且至关重要的任务

    它不仅关乎虚拟机(VM)之间的通信效率,还直接影响到与外部网络的交互能力、资源隔离以及整体系统的安全性

    在PVE平台上,有效的网络管理能够确保: 1.高性能通信:通过合理配置网络,减少延迟,提高数据传输速率,满足关键业务应用对实时性的要求

     2.灵活的资源分配:支持复杂的网络拓扑结构,如VLAN(虚拟局域网)、桥接、NAT(网络地址转换)等,使资源分配更加灵活,适应不同应用场景

     3.增强的安全性:通过防火墙规则、网络隔离等手段,有效抵御外部攻击,保护虚拟机免受未授权访问和数据泄露的风险

     4.简化的管理:提供直观的界面和强大的API支持,简化网络配置和管理流程,降低运维成本

     二、PVE虚拟机网络管理的基础架构 PVE的网络管理基于Linux内核的网络堆栈,利用桥接、绑定、路由等机制实现复杂的网络功能

    其核心组件包括: - vmbr0(默认桥接接口):所有新建的虚拟机默认连接到此桥接网络,除非另有指定

    它模拟了一个物理交换机,允许虚拟机在同一子网内相互通信,并能访问外部网络

     - VLAN配置:通过VLAN标签,可以在单个物理网络上划分多个逻辑子网,实现资源的逻辑隔离和访问控制

     - 防火墙规则:PVE内置了iptables防火墙,允许管理员定义精细的访问控制策略,保护虚拟机免受潜在威胁

     - 绑定(Bonding):通过绑定多个物理网络接口,提供冗余和负载均衡,增强网络连接的可靠性和带宽

     - NAT与路由:支持NAT转换,允许虚拟机使用私有IP地址访问外部网络,同时保持内部网络的隐蔽性;路由功能则可实现不同子网间的数据转发

     三、实施策略与实践 1. 网络规划与设计 在实施PVE虚拟机网络管理之前,首要任务是进行详尽的网络规划

    这包括确定网络拓扑结构(如星型、总线型)、子网划分、IP地址分配、网关设置等

    同时,考虑未来的扩展性,预留足够的网络资源和地址空间

     2. 配置vmbr0及VLAN 默认情况下,PVE会在安装时创建一个名为vmbr0的桥接接口

    管理员可以通过Web GUI或命令行工具调整其设置,如修改MTU(最大传输单元)、启用STP(生成树协议)等

    对于需要VLAN隔离的环境,可以通过添加VLAN子接口(如vmbr0.10)来实现,每个子接口对应一个VLAN ID,从而创建多个逻辑网络

     3. 防火墙规则配置 利用PVE内置的iptables防火墙,管理员可以定义入站和出站规则,精确控制网络流量

    例如,限制特定IP地址的访问权限、开放或封闭特定端口等

    合理配置防火墙是提升系统安全性的关键步骤

     4. 网络绑定与冗余 对于关键业务应用,采用网络绑定技术可以显著提高网络的可靠性和带宽

    PVE支持多种绑定模式,如active-backup、balance-xor、broadcast等,根据具体需求选择合适的模式

    配置时需注意物理接口的兼容性和性能影响

     5. 高级路由与NAT 在复杂的网络环境中,可能需要配置静态路由或策略路由来优化数据流

    此外,对于需要访问互联网但又不希望暴露内部IP地址的虚拟机,可以通过配置NAT规则实现

    PVE提供了灵活的工具来管理这些高级网络功能

     四、优化与安全考量 性能优化 - 网络调优:根据工作负载特性调整TCP/IP参数,如窗口大小、拥塞控制算法等,以提升网络性能

     - 硬件加速:利用支持硬件卸载的网络接口卡(NIC),减轻CPU负担,提高数据传输效率

     安全加固 - 定期审计:定期审查网络配置和防火墙规则,确保没有不必要的开放端口或服务

     - 安全更新:及时应用PVE及其依赖组件的安全补丁,防范已知漏洞

     - 隔离策略:严格实施网络隔离,特别是敏感数据和关键业务系统的网络应与其他部分隔离

     五、结论 PVE虚拟机网络管理是一项复杂但至关重要的任务,它直接关系到虚拟化环境的性能、灵活性和安全性

    通过合理的网络规划、精细的配置管理以及持续的优化与安全加固,可以构建一个高效、可靠且安全的虚拟网络环境

    随着技术的不断进步和应用的日益复杂,掌握PVE网络管理的精髓,对于提升整体IT架构的效能和响应速度至关重要

    无论是对于寻求数字化转型的企业,还是致力于提升运维效率的数据中心管理者,深入理解并有效实施PVE虚拟机网络管理,都是迈向成功的重要一步

    

nat123映射怎么用?超详细步骤,外网访问内网轻松搞定
nat123域名怎么用?两种方式轻松搞定
nat123怎么用?简单几步实现内网穿透
内网穿透工具对比:nat123、花生壳与轻量新选择
远程访问内网很简单:用对工具,一“箭”穿透
ngrok下载完全指南:从入门到获取客户端
内网远程桌面软件:穿透局域网边界的数字窗口
从外网远程访问内网服务器的完整方案
Windows Server 2008端口转发完全教程:netsh命令添加/查看/删除/重置
为什么三层交换机转发比Linux服务器快?转发表硬件加速的秘密